Reliable pumping equipment is essential for contractors working on demanding grouting projects. The Blastcrete D3522 Attachment is a hydraulic-powered pumping solution designed for hot epoxy grouting contractors who already have a suitable hydraulic power unit.
As a Hydraulic Grout Pump, the D3522 provides variable-speed pumping from 0 to 6 cubic yards per hour and can deliver up to 400 PSI pumping pressure. Its simple squeeze-pump design is intended to provide dependable performance while making operation and maintenance straightforward.
Understanding the D3522 Hydraulic Grout Pump
The D3522 Attachment is designed to connect to an existing hydraulic power unit. This allows contractors to use their available hydraulic equipment to operate the pump rather than requiring a separate dedicated power source.
At the heart of the system is a 2-inch hydraulic squeeze pump driven by a heavy-duty planetary gearbox. The design is particularly suited to hot epoxy grouting applications where controlled and consistent pumping is required.
The D3522 can provide variable output between 0 and 6 cubic yards per hour, allowing operators to regulate pumping speed according to the requirements of the project.

How the D3522 Attachment Works
The operating concept of the D3522 Attachment is straightforward. The attachment is coupled to a compatible hydraulic power unit, which supplies the hydraulic energy needed to operate the squeeze pump.
The hydraulic system drives the heavy-duty planetary gearbox, which operates the 2-inch squeeze pump. Material is pumped through the system at a controllable rate.
A key design characteristic is that the epoxy material does not come into contact with the moving parts of the pump. This helps reduce direct exposure of mechanical components to the pumped material and supports long equipment life.

D3522 Attachment Specifications
Specification D3522 Attachment
Pump Type 2" Hydraulic Squeeze Pump
Drive System Heavy-Duty Planetary Gearbox
Output Capacity 0–6 cubic yards per hour
Maximum Pumping Pressure Up to 400 PSI
Hydraulic Oil Requirement 10 GPM @ 3,000 PSI
Length 76"
Width 37"
Height 39"
Hopper Charging Height 28"
